In most instances, the process for linking a new replacement keys to your car is very simple. Simply insert the key, rotate it to run and it will synchronize with your car. The key will allow you to start and lock your car.

If your vehicle is older than 2013, you may need to have it activated by an advisor from the service department. Before they can activate your model, they will need to know your chassis number as well as your security code.

The dealership will also require you to bring in your current and original vehicle registration, as well as an unsigned letter from you specifying them as the authorized party to receive the key and take it home with you once it's programmed. Depending on the year and model of your Mercedes the process could take anywhere between two and three days.

Whatever type of key fob you have it is essential to change the batteries on a regular basis. You could experience issues like decreased range or buttons that aren't functioning if change your battery on your key fob frequently.

These are the steps to change your Mercedes key's batteries. First, identify the type of key you have. A Chrome Smart Key, for instance requires the CR2025 lithium battery. If you're using an older Smart Key, it will need two CR2025 batteries. Once you've identified the type of battery you need, you can purchase it online or in-store at your local Ace Hardware store.
